POLICE have warned road users to be extra careful during the Heroes ad Defence Forces holidays, a period that is normally associated with frequent road accidents.

In an interview, Manicaland provincial police spokesperson Inspector Norbert Muzondo warned motorists against driving while drunk.

He urged all road users to exercise caution.

“We really want to urge all road users to be extra careful on the road during this Heroes holiday. Motorists are urged to observe regulations on the road as well as ensure that their vehicles are in good condition. It is also imperative that people plan their journeys on time to avoid speeding on the road. We wish everyone a peaceful and exciting Heroes holiday.”
